2015-02-06 69 views
-1

我定義爲控制器:模態空檢查屬性

public ModelAndView execute(final HttpServletRequest request, @ModelAttribute final UploadFormBean anObject) { 
    //some code 
} 

我的問題是關於anObject空檢查。這是否有意義:anObject != null。請解釋你的答案。

回答

2

anObject將永遠不會爲null,因爲Spring MVC將實例化它。

下面是從documentation

鑑於上面的例子中寵物實例,其中可以來自一個報價?有幾個選項:

...

  • 它可以使用其默認的構造函數實例化。
+0

是的。同樣的想法。有一個遺留的代碼,想看看我的想法是否正確。 – 2015-02-06 01:22:00

+0

我試圖找到這個記錄的位置,如果我這樣做,將更新我的答案和參考... – 2015-02-06 01:26:37